We’re looking for a BUYING AND PRODUCT DEVELOPMENT ASSISTANT to join our team.

JOB TITLEBuying and Product Development Assistant

JOB TYPE

Full Time

JOB PURPOSETo provide crucial administrative support to our Accessories Buying and Product Development team. You will support the team throughout the entire product lifecycle, from initial design concept to the product landing instore/online.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Critical Path Management

To pro-actively track product throughout the entire lifecycle to ensure on time deliveries, from receiving first proto through to the bulk order leaving the factory. This will include daily communication with suppliers to seek accurate updates on all orders, as well as leading weekly tracking meetings with the internal team to update on all orders. You will be responsible for inputting the information into our Range Plan, and keeping it permanently updated.

Order Process

To accurately raise, amend and maintain all purchase orders and order details in a timely manner when instructed to do so by the team. You will use our internal NAV system whilst cross checking the department Range Plan, and will be responsible for ensuring all information is 100% correct and properly checked before sending to suppliers.

Sample/Swatch Management

You will be responsible for full organisation of the sample and swatch library, from posting/tracking deliveries of samples/swatches to/from suppliers, to ensuring our sample/swatch cupboards are efficiently organised and cleared when necessary, as well as general tidiness of the department as a whole. You will also be expected to pull the relevant/correct samples/swatches for Sign Offs, Fit Sessions/Approvals, Monday Trade, and all other ad hoc meetings. You will also be responsible for providing the press, web and photography teams with the relevant samples as and when required.

Supplier Communication

You will be communicating daily with suppliers, from sending supplier set up forms, retrieving cost prices/product information, posting swatches/dips, sending print/tech packs, to sending the purchase orders. You will also be expected to keep the supplier tracker updated as and when new suppliers are introduced or when T&C’s change, as well as checking supplier invoices and communicating errors when necessary.

Product ExecutionYou will support the team to ensure the execution of product, in both stores and online, is reflective of the brand vision and standards. This will involve ensuring product copy and photography deadlines are met, as well as sending memo’s to stores when instructed. You will be responsible for checking our website on a weekly basis to ensure imagery and copy is correct, as well as visiting stores and feeding back on VM/other relevant information.
